- Design and Power Needs: Gravity systems, which use natural slopes for flow, cost less and require no electricity. Pumped versions add $500 to $1,000 but suit level yards or indoor reuse.
- Home Configuration: Straightforward access to drains in modern homes keeps labor under $1,000. In older structures, trenching or rerouting pipes can increase expenses by 25 percent.
- Reuse Applications: Irrigation-only setups simplify at lower costs, while multi-use systems for flushing or laundry demand robust treatment, elevating prices.
- Regulatory Requirements: Local codes may mandate permits ($100 to $300) or backflow preventers. Compliance ensures safe operation and avoids fines.
Homeowners report on forums that scaling systems to match daily water output, around 20 to 40 gallons per person, maximizes value. Avoid overbuilding, as excess capacity yields diminishing returns.
Calculating Payback and Long-Term Savings
Most greywater installations recoup costs in three to five years through reduced bills. Average households save $250 to $600 yearly on water and sewage fees, based on national rates of $0.005 to $0.010 per gallon. In high-cost areas like California, payback accelerates to two years.
Utilities in water-scarce zones provide incentives, such as rebates up to $1,000 or tax credits, offsetting 20 to 40 percent of upfront expenses. During shortages, these systems maintain yard vitality and indoor functions, adding practical resilience.
For property owners, greywater enhances market appeal. Energy-efficient homes with built-in sustainability features sell 5 to 10 percent faster, according to real estate trends, boosting resale value by thousands.
Selecting and Sizing the Ideal System
Start by auditing your home's water usage with a simple meter or app to identify high-volume sources. Soil tests determine irrigation viability; sandy loams absorb greywater best, while clay may need aeration.
Opt for systems with certifications from bodies like NSF International for pathogen removal efficacy. Brands such as Aquacell and Greywater Action offer scalable kits with user-friendly manuals. Seek models with transparent tanks for easy inspection and modular components for future expansion.
Consult at least three certified installers for bids, requesting details on warranties (typically 5 to 10 years) and energy efficiency ratings. Prioritize those experienced in local codes to streamline approvals.
Step-by-Step Installation Guidance
Simple outdoor systems suit handy homeowners. Begin by mapping drain lines and selecting a discharge site away from edibles or foundations. Install a three-way valve on the washing machine outlet, connect PVC pipes to a lined basin, and add lint filters to prevent blockages.
Professional setups for indoor applications involve licensed plumbers to integrate pumps, chlorinators, and sensors. They ensure air gaps and purple piping distinguish non-potable lines, meeting health standards.
Post-installation, test flows and monitor for 48 hours. Use biodegradable soaps to maintain water quality; switch to plant-safe varieties if odors arise.
Ensuring Longevity Through Maintenance
Routine care keeps systems performing at peak. Clean pre-filters biweekly with a hose, and inspect pumps quarterly for wear. Annual professional tune-ups, costing $150, catch issues early.
Track savings with utility comparisons and adjust usage as needed. Smart integrations, like app-connected sensors, provide real-time data on volume and quality, preventing downtime.
